Businesses in Greenwood selling across states or online platforms must handle constantly changing sales tax rules, Nexus triggers, and product taxability regulations. Our Sales Tax Compliance service helps Greenwood companies stay compliant by managing filings, monitoring Nexus, and reconciling monthly tax obligations with clean accuracy.
We refresh your Greenwood compliance process by identifying Nexus risks, organizing tax categories, aligning marketplace/eCommerce channels, and establishing a monthly reconciliation workflow. This eliminates filing errors, reduces penalties, and brings clarity to your Greenwood financial reporting.
